The Body Balancing &Strengthening Program

  It Deals With:

 •  Injury Rehabilitation

 •  Sport-Specific Training

 •  Weight Loss

 

 

Injury rehabilitation deals with working alongside the individual’s physiotherapist to balance the body through strengthening weak areas of concern, improving movement patterns in tight or inhibited areas as well as addressing the root cause of the injury.

If an injury is not corrected within 6 weeks the body adapts forcing other tissues and systems to take on more load. So although symptoms may subside, chronic imbalances become engrained until such time as the root cause is examined and corrected.

 

Each sport has particular movement patterns and requires specific cardiovascular capacities and muscle strengthening. This Body Balancing & Strengthening program assesses the sport and the player’s needs; the training targets both to reduce the risk of injury and to optimise performance.

 

When weight loss is the goal an exercise program will be more effective when combined with dietary controls. From an exercise standpoint, sessions will involve cardiovascular training, in the form of interval training, and strengthening work to increase the muscle mass so even the resting metabolic rate is increased.
